Está en la página 1de 3

AppNroComplejo

package appnrocomplejo;

public static void main(String[] args) {


CNroComplejo c1;
CNroComplejo c2;
CNroComplejo c3;
CNroComplejo c4;
c1=new CNroComplejo();
c2=new CNroComplejo(3,4);
c3=new CNroComplejo(1,2);
c4=new CNroComplejo();
c1.modificarReal(5);
c1.modificarImaginario(6);
System.out.println("La parte real es:"+c1.seleccionarReal());
System.out.println("La parte imaginaria
es:"+c1.seleccionarImaginario());
System.out.println("La parte real es:"+c2.seleccionarReal());
System.out.println("La parte imaginaria
es:"+c2.seleccionarImaginario());
c3.escribirComplejo();
c4.sumar(c2, c3);
c4.escribirComplejo();
}
}
CNroComplejo
package appnrocomplejo;

public class CNroComplejo {


//Atributos
private float aReal;
private float aImaginario;

//Constructores
public CNroComplejo(){
aReal=0;
aImaginario=0;
}
public CNroComplejo(float pReal,float pImaginario){
aReal=pReal;
aImaginario=pImaginario;
}
//Modificadores
public void modificarReal(float pReal){
aReal=pReal;
}
public void modificarImaginario(float pImaginario){
aImaginario=pImaginario;
}
//Selectores
public float seleccionarReal(){
return aReal;
}
public float seleccionarImaginario(){
return aImaginario;
}
//Otros Metodos
public void conjugada(){
aImaginario=-aImaginario;
}
public void sumar(CNroComplejo x,CNroComplejo y){
aReal=x.aReal+y.aReal;
aImaginario=x.aImaginario+y.aImaginario;

public void escribirComplejo(){


System.out.println(+aReal+"+"+aImaginario+"i");
}}

También podría gustarte